Rejection' can be referred to as a state of being unwanted or non-acceptance of one's beliefs, opinions, or ideas by others. It is a state of being abandoned, disowned, or ostracised by loved ones. Rejection is one social problem that has caused many people serious emotional and psychological problems. It has bred low self-esteem, self-pity, a lack of self-confidence, and possibly suicide in many people.

As a result of this, the book TURNING REJECTION TO RECEPTION has been written. The book has been published to help victims of rejection overcome the scourge, while bouncing back to becoming 'chief cornerstones' in their careers, academics, and other areas of life. It has been put together to help victims turn rejection into a stepping stone rather than a stumbling block to success.

The book contains about 12 wonderful stories of Individuals (both from the Bible and real life) who suffered acute rejection, ostracization, and segregation from others but later bounced back to becoming 'chief cornerstones'.

Consequently, everyone struggling with rejection (in whatever area of life) will find this book a useful self-help spiritual guide that brings one out of social rejection into social prominence and acceptance. Welcome on board!
